We offer a career development opportunity in highway and drainage infrastructure. Currently, we are seeking to employ a Civil Engineering Apprentice within our Infrastructure Design Team. This role involves working towards a Civil Engineering Degree Apprenticeship (BEng Hons) at the University of Portsmouth.
As an apprentice, you will collaborate with peers and experienced staff, gaining practical experience while studying for a Level 6 Civil Engineering qualification.
Your Day-to-day Work Will Include
* Using industry-standard software such as AutoCAD
* Developing technical highway and drainage designs for planning applications and detailed design stages
* Assisting in preparing technical reports, including Flood Risk Assessments, Sustainable Drainage, and Foul Water Technical Notes
* Conducting technical assessments for new developments
* Liaising with third parties and Statutory Undertakers to support projects
* Ensuring compliance with industry standards, design guides, and regulations
* Supporting the team to deliver projects on time and within budget
You will spend one day a week at university and four days in the workplace, receiving on-the-job training and support from a friendly team eager to involve you from day one.
Working hours are Monday to Friday, 9 am to 5:30 pm, including a one-hour lunch break.
